51Testing软件测试论坛

标题: QTP找不到模拟录制功能? [打印本页]

作者: sswmjoy    时间: 2013-8-4 14:26
标题: QTP找不到模拟录制功能?
最近遇到一个比较特殊的动作,就是用鼠标拖拽,不知道VB怎样写,就想用模拟录制录下,发现竟然找不到,普通录制时也没有鼠标的标志,Automation中也没有Analog recording,求大神们解答
作者: 黑羽祭    时间: 2013-8-5 09:14
回复 1# sswmjoy


    你用的QTP什么版本。10.的在Record红色点录制按钮右边第3个按钮
作者: sswmjoy    时间: 2013-8-5 13:55
回复 2# 黑羽祭

谢谢!我找到原因了,打开QTP后再打开test是有模拟录制的,但把我的脚本文件夹拖到QTP图标上然后启动后模拟录制就消失了,不知道是什么问题
作者: 黑羽祭    时间: 2013-8-5 15:37
回复 3# sswmjoy


    还是规范操作吧,别偷懒了。
作者: sswmjoy    时间: 2013-8-6 10:14
回复 4# 黑羽祭


版主。。。如果我告诉你 我是小A。。你怎么想
作者: 黑羽祭    时间: 2013-8-6 17:06
回复 5# sswmjoy


    我去~哈哈哈哈哈哈
穿了个马甲都认不出来了
作者: 黑羽祭    时间: 2013-8-6 17:30
回复 5# sswmjoy


    你要是真想偷懒,我也有办法,告诉你个我以前用的偷懒小方法。Office玩的好么?Office的Excel里,
1.首先在Excel选项中的信任中心,开启宏的信任;然后在常用中,开启“开发工具”
2.在开发工具里尽情的加按钮吧,然后对按钮进行编程,写入下面之类的脚本
  1. Sub 按钮_Click()
  2. Dim qtApp
  3. '创建QTP实例
  4. Set qtApp = CreateObject("QuickTest.Application")
  5. '启动QTP实例
  6. qtApp.Launch
  7. qtApp.Visible = True
  8. '打开相应的QTP脚本(如脚本为保存在D盘的Test1)
  9. qtApp.Open "D:\Test1"
  10. End Sub
复制代码


点击下Excel中的按钮  就能启动QTP并加载脚本,而且Excel也可以帮助你管理脚本。
还可以吧路径放到外面的表格里,写宏去读。
反正方法很多,用好了很高效




欢迎光临 51Testing软件测试论坛 (http://bbs.51testing.com/) Powered by Discuz! X3.2